首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

phpcms 模板导入

基础概念

phpcms 是一个基于 PHP 的内容管理系统(CMS),它提供了丰富的功能来帮助用户管理和发布网站内容。模板导入是 phpcms 中的一个功能,允许用户将预先设计好的 HTML 模板导入到系统中,以便快速生成和发布网站页面。

相关优势

  1. 提高效率:通过模板导入,可以快速生成多个页面,节省手动创建页面的时间。
  2. 统一风格:导入的模板可以确保网站各个页面的风格一致,提升用户体验。
  3. 灵活性:用户可以根据需要选择不同的模板,以满足不同的设计需求。

类型

phpcms 的模板导入通常分为以下几种类型:

  1. 静态模板导入:将 HTML 文件直接导入到系统中,系统会将其作为静态页面处理。
  2. 动态模板导入:导入的模板中包含 PHP 代码,系统会根据这些代码动态生成页面内容。
  3. 主题模板导入:导入整个主题包,包括多个模板文件、CSS 文件、JavaScript 文件等。

应用场景

  1. 网站重构:在网站重构时,可以通过导入模板快速生成新的页面结构。
  2. 多站点管理:对于需要管理多个站点的用户,可以通过导入模板快速部署相同风格的网站。
  3. 内容更新:当网站内容需要大规模更新时,可以通过导入模板快速生成新的页面。

常见问题及解决方法

问题:模板导入失败

原因

  1. 模板文件格式不正确。
  2. 模板文件路径错误。
  3. 系统权限问题。

解决方法

  1. 检查模板文件的格式,确保其为 HTML 或 PHP 格式。
  2. 确认模板文件的路径是否正确,确保文件可以被系统访问。
  3. 检查系统权限,确保有足够的权限读取和写入模板文件。

问题:模板导入后页面显示不正确

原因

  1. 模板中的代码错误。
  2. 模板与系统不兼容。
  3. 数据库配置错误。

解决方法

  1. 检查模板中的代码,确保没有语法错误。
  2. 确认模板与 phpcms 版本兼容。
  3. 检查数据库配置,确保数据能够正确读取和显示。

示例代码

以下是一个简单的 phpcms 模板导入示例:

代码语言:txt
复制
<?php
// 导入模板文件
$template_file = 'path/to/template.html';
if (file_exists($template_file)) {
    $template_content = file_get_contents($template_file);
    // 将模板内容保存到数据库或文件系统中
    // ...
} else {
    echo '模板文件不存在';
}
?>

参考链接

phpcms 官方文档

phpcms 模板导入教程

通过以上信息,您应该能够更好地理解 phpcms 模板导入的相关概念、优势、类型、应用场景以及常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 模板继承与导入

    模板继承的场景 情况1:通常写页面都有个模板用来框定头部LOGO页面,左侧导航菜单,只有右部的内容不同。如果不使用模板就大量重复工作。    ...django 通过模板继承解决。 情况2:一个页面如果内容特别多,不可能都一起写同一个页面。比如京东首页内容非常多。如何解决了?django通过include导入其他页面。...解决方法: 在模板里css 和js位置在写个block块。...然后在block里引入,在这个block写自己的js和css 注:block和顺序没有关系 二:模板引入使用 3)一个页面只能继承一个模板,如何解决了?...如何使用多个模板,或者引入其他页面      可以引用多次  4)模板,include,子页面怎么渲染?

    54250

    选择PHPCMS的理由

    在众多CMS系统中,为什么我偏偏选中了 PHPCMS 而不去选择使用人数最多的织梦CMS,也没有选择论坛人气很高的帝国CMS,更没有选择其他诸如齐博,DESTOON等CMS。...PHPCMS使用方便 每更新一篇文章会自动更新首页以及文章所在栏目页,不像其他CMS每次更新完毕后,还要点击生成首页,生成栏目页,多麻烦啊。...即使文章中包含了'我很爱你'这个词,但是却已跟其他词组合成了锚文本,那么就不会再替换,如'爱你','其实我很爱你' PHPCMS扩展性强 使用PHPCMS扩展性能非常强,进行二次开发相比其他程序更加的容易...phpcms有哪些缺点 任何一款CMS都不是完美的,phpcms同样如此。...这也正是PHPCMS的魅力所在。

    8.9K40
    领券